  • Could sound be used as a strategy for reducing symptoms of perceived motion sickness?
  • 2008
  • Ingår i: Journal of NeuroEngineering and Rehabilitation. - : Springer Science and Business Media LLC. - 1743-0003. ; 5:35
  • Tidskriftsartikel (refereegranskat)abstract
    • Background: Working while exposed to motions, physically and psychologically affects a person. Traditionally, motion sickness symptom reduction has implied use of medication, which can lead to detrimental effects on performance. Non-pharmaceutical strategies, in turn, often require cognitive and perceptual attention. Hence, for people working in high demand environments where it is impossible to reallocate focus of attention, other strategies are called upon. The aim of the study was to investigate possible impact of a mitigation strategy on perceived motion sickness and psychophysiological responses, based on an artificial sound horizon compared with a non-positioned sound source.Method: Twenty-three healthy subjects were seated on a motion platform in an artificial sound horizon or in non-positioned sound, in random order with one week interval between the trials. Perceived motion sickness (Mal), maximum duration of exposure (ST), skin conductance, blood volume pulse, temperature, respiration rate, eye movements and heart rate were measured continuously throughout the trials.Results: Mal scores increased over time in both sound conditions, but the artificial sound horizon, applied as a mitigation strategy for perceived motion sickness, showed no significant effect on Mal scores or ST. The number of fixations increased with time in the non-positioned sound condition. Moreover, fixation time was longer in the nonpositioned sound condition compared with sound horizon, indicating that the subjects used more time to fixate and, hence, assumingly made fewer saccades.Conclusion: A subliminally presented artificial sound horizon did not significantly affect perceived motion sickness, psychophysiological variables or the time the subjects endured the motion sickness triggering stimuli. The number of fixations and fixation times increased over time in the non-positioned sound condition.

  • Effects of Motion Sickness on Encoding and Retrieval
  • 2010
  • Tidskriftsartikel (refereegranskat)abstract
    • Objective: In this study, possible effects of motion sickness on encoding and retrieval of words were investigated. Background: The impact of motion sickness on human performance has been studied with regards to psychomotor functions and over learned skills, as well as to novel situations requiring encoding and retrieval skills through the use of short term memory. In this study, possible effects of motion sickness on encoding and retrieval of words were investigated. Method: Forty healthy participants, half of them males, performed a continuous recognition task (CRT) during exposure to a motion sickness triggering optokinetic drum. The CRT was employed as a measurement of performance and consisted of encoding and retrieval of words. The task consisted of three consecutive phases 1) encoding of familiar words; 2) encoding and retrieval of words under the influence of motion sickness; 3) retrieval of words after exposure. Results: Data analysis revealed no significant differences in the ability to encode or retrieve words during motion sickness compared with a control condition. In addition, there were no significant correlations between the level of motion sickness and performance of the CRT. Conclusion: The results indicate that encoding and retrieval of words are not affected by moderate levels of motion sickness. Application: This research has implications for operational settings where professionals experience moderate levels of motion sickness.

  • Performance and Autonomic Responses during Motion Sickness
  • 2009
  • Ingår i: Human Factors. - : SAGE Publications. - 0018-7208 .- 1547-8181. ; 51:1, s. 56-66
  • Tidskriftsartikel (refereegranskat)abstract
    • Objective: The aim of the study was to investigate how motion sickness, triggered by an optokinetic drum, affects short term memory performance and to explore autonomic responses to perceived motion sickness. Background: Previous research has found motion sickness to decrease performance, but it is not known how short term memory in particular is affected. Method: Thirty-eight healthy participants performed a listening span test while seated in a rotating optokinetic drum. Measurements of motion sickness, performance, heart rate, skin conductance, blood volume pulse, and pupil size were performed simultaneously throughout the experiment. Results: A total of 16 participants terminated the trial due to severe nausea, while the other 22 endured the full 25 minutes. Perceived motion sickness increased over time in both groups, but less among those who endured the trial. Short term memory performance decreased towards the end for those who terminated, while it increased for the other group. Results from the measured autonomic responses were ambiguous. Conclusion: The present study concludes that performance, measured as short term memory, declines as perceived motion sickness progresses. Application: This research has potential implications for command and control personnel in risk of developing motion sickness.

  • Psychophysiological and Performance Aspects on Motion Sickness
  • 2009
  • Doktorsavhandling (övrigt vetenskapligt/konstnärligt)abstract
    • Motion sickness is not an illness, but rather a natural autonomic response to an unfamiliar or specific stimulus. The bodily responses to motion sickness are highly individual and contextually dependent, making them difficult to predict. The initial autonomic responses are similar to the ones demonstrated when under stress. When under the influence of motion sickness, motivation and ability to perform tasks or duties are limited. However, little is known about how specific cognitive functions are affected. Furthermore, standard mitigation strategies involve medications that induce fatigue or strategies that require cognitive capabilities. Both of them may result in reduced capability to perform assigned tasks or duties. Hence, there is a need for alternative mitigation strategies.The aim of the thesis was to study psychophysiological and performance aspects on motion sickness. The long-term goal is to provide strategies for mitigation and prevention of motion sickness by identifying psychophysiological responses as predictors for both wellbeing and performance. This thesis comprises four studies, in which 91 participants were exposed to two different motion sickness stimuli, either an optokinetic drum or a motion platform. Before the tests, a method for extracting fixations from eye-tracking data was developed as a prerequisite for studying fixations as a possible mitigation strategy for reducing motion sickness. During exposure to stimuli that triggers motion sickness, performance was studied by testing short-term memory and encoding and retrieval. In the final study, the effects of an artificial sound horizon were studied with respect to its potential to subconsciously function as a mitigating source.The results of the measurements of the psychophysiological responses were in accordance with previous research, confirming the ambiguity and high individuality of the responses as well as their contextual dependencies. To study fixations, a centroid mode algorithm proved to be the best way to generate fixations from eye-movement data. In the final study, the effects of the sound horizon were compared to the effects of a non-positioned sound. In the latter condition, both fixation time and the number of fixations increased over time, whereas none of them showed a significant time effect in the sound horizon condition. The fixation time slope was significantly larger in the non-positioned sound condition compared to the sound horizon condition. Number of fixations, heart rate, and skin conductance correlated positively with subjective statements that referred to motion sickness. Among participants that were susceptible to motion sickness symptoms, short-term memory performance was negatively affected. However, no effects of motion sickness on encoding and retrieval were found, regardless of susceptibility.Future studies should continue focusing on autonomic responses and psychological issues of motion sickness. Factors such as motivation, expectancies, and previous experiences play a major and yet relatively unknown role within the motion sickness phenomena.

  • Get it right, make it easy, see it all : Viewpoints of autistic individuals and parents of autistic individuals about the autism diagnostic process in Australia
  • 2021
  • Ingår i: Research in Autism Spectrum Disorders. - : Elsevier. - 1750-9467 .- 1878-0237. ; 85
  • Tidskriftsartikel (refereegranskat)abstract
    • Background: The clinical process for being evaluated for an autism diagnosis is often time consuming and stressful for individuals and their caregivers. While experience of and satisfaction with the diagnostic process has been reviewed in the literature, few studies have directly investigated the viewpoints of individuals diagnosed with autism and caregivers of autistic individuals about what is important in the autism diagnostic process.Method: A Q methodological design was employed to capture the subjective viewpoints about the diagnostic process of individuals on the autism spectrum and caregivers of autistic individuals. Thirty-eight participants responded to a set of 66 statements representing different aspects of the autism diagnostic process.Results: The analysis identified three significant viewpoints: Get it Right, Make it Easy, and See it All. Participants reflected upon the importance of a comprehensive diagnostic assessment process, ease of diagnostic processes, and a holistic approach to autism diagnosis for autistic individuals and caregivers of autistic individuals.Conclusions: The findings provide a consumer perspective that encourages reform of the current process for diagnosing autism in Australia, and an insight into what consumers are wanting from diagnostic services. This information is useful for policy-makers and service providers to create a more supportive and client-centred diagnostic process at all levels of service delivery.

  • Viewpoints of pedestrians with and without cognitive impairment on shared zones and zebra crossings
  • 2018
  • Ingår i: PLOS ONE. - : Public Library of Science. - 1932-6203. ; 13:9
  • Tidskriftsartikel (refereegranskat)abstract
    • BackgroundShared zones are characterised by an absence of traditional markers that segregate the road and footpath. Negotiation of a shared zone relies on an individual’s ability to perceive, assess and respond to environmental cues. This ability may be impacted by impairments in cognitive processing, which may lead to individuals experiencing increased anxiety when negotiating a shared zone.MethodQ method was used in order to identify and explore the viewpoints of pedestrians, with and without cognitive impairments as they pertain to shared zones.ResultsTwo viewpoints were revealed. Viewpoint one was defined by “confident users” while viewpoint two was defined by users who “know what [they] are doing but drivers might not”.DiscussionOverall, participants in the study would not avoid shared zones. Pedestrians with intellectual disability were, however, not well represented by either viewpoint, suggesting that shared zones may pose a potential barrier to participation for this group.

  • Visual search strategies in a shared zone in pedestrians with and without intellectual disability
  • 2019
  • Ingår i: Research in Developmental Disabilities. - : Elsevier. - 0891-4222 .- 1873-3379. ; 94
  • Tidskriftsartikel (refereegranskat)abstract
    • People with intellectual disability (ID) may find shared zones troublesome to negotiate because of the lack of the traditional clearly defined rules and boundaries. With the built environment identified as a barrier to active travel and community access, it is vital to explore how pedestrians with ID navigate shared zones to ensure that this group is not placed in harm's way or discouraged from active travel because of the implications of shared zones. This study investigated the visual strategies of 19 adults with ID and 21 controls who wore head mounted eye trackers in a Shared Zone and at a zebra crossing (as a contrast traffic environment). In total 4750 valid fixations were analysed. Participants with ID fixated on traffic relevant objects at a rate of 68 percent of the control participants. Furthermore, the males with ID were 9(4.4–18.7) times more likely to fixate on non-traffic relevant objects compared with traffic relevant objects, much higher odds than that of females with ID 1.8(0.4–1.7). Zebra crossings appeared to act as a cue, drawing pedestrians' visual attention to the traffic environment, with both groups more likely to look at traffic relevant objects on/at the zebra crossing (66%: 34%). Future implementation of shared zones needs to be carefully considered in relation to the safety of road users with ID and their capacity to identify and assess salient environmental information.

  • Visual search strategies of pedestrians with and without visual and cognitive impairments in a shared zone : A proof of concept study
  • 2016
  • Ingår i: Land use policy. - : Elsevier. - 0264-8377 .- 1873-5754. ; 57, s. 327-334
  • Tidskriftsartikel (refereegranskat)abstract
    • Shared zones have gained increasing popularity in urban land use and design as a means of incorporating the needs of multiple modes of transport, while at the same time promoting social interaction between users. Interactions within shared zones are based on a set of informal social protocols, communicated via eye contact and social cues. This proof of concept study utilised eye-tracking technology to examine the visual search strategies of individuals, with and without visual and cognitive impairments as they navigated a strategically chosen shared zone. In total 3960 fixations were analysed and the fixations were distributed across the shared zone and a pedestrian crossing. Those with impairments were more likely to fixate on traffic specific areas and objects compared to those without, suggesting that they required more input ascertaining when and where it was safe to perform tasks. However, the duration of fixation was not significantly different for an object whether it was traffic related or not, indicating a global need for increased processing time of the surrounding environment. Shared zones are claimed to increase driver awareness and safety and reduce congestion, but the implications on participation and safety for those with visual and cognitive impairments is yet to be extensively explored.

  • The complexity of role balance: Support for the Model of Juggling Occupations
  • 2014
  • Ingår i: Scandinavian Journal of Occupational Therapy. - : Informa UK Limited. - 1103-8128 .- 1651-2014. ; 21:5, s. 334-347
  • Tidskriftsartikel (refereegranskat)abstract
    • Objective: This pilot study aimed to establish the appropriateness of the Model of Juggling Occupations in exploring the complex experience of role balance amongst working women with family responsibilities living in Perth, Australia.Methods: In meeting this aim, an evaluation was conducted of a case study design, where data were collected through a questionnaire, time diary, and interview.Results: Overall role balance varied over time and across participants. Positive indicators of role balance occurred frequently in the questionnaires and time diaries, despite the interviews revealing a predominance of negative evaluations of role balance. Between-role balance was achieved through compatible role overlap, buffering, and renewal. An exploration of within-role balance factors demonstrated that occupational participation, values, interests, personal causation, and habits were related to role balance.Conclusions: This pilot study concluded that the Model of Juggling Occupations is an appropriate conceptual framework to explore the complex and dynamic experience of role balance amongst working women with family responsibilities. It was also confirmed that the case study design, including the questionnaire, time diary, and interview methods, is suitable for researching role balance from this perspective.
